The JANTX2N5745 belongs to the category of high-power, high-frequency transistors.
It is commonly used in applications requiring high power and high frequency, such as in RF amplifiers and oscillators.
The JANTX2N5745 is typically available in a metal can package with three leads.
The essence of the JANTX2N5745 lies in its ability to amplify high-frequency signals with high power handling capacity.
It is usually packaged in reels or tubes, with quantities varying based on manufacturer specifications.
The JANTX2N5745 transistor has three pins: 1. Base (B) 2. Emitter (E) 3. Collector (C)
The JANTX2N5745 offers the following functional features: - High power amplification - Wide frequency range operation - Low noise performance
The JANTX2N5745 operates based on the principles of bipolar junction transistors, utilizing the flow of charge carriers to amplify high-frequency signals.
The JANTX2N5745 is well-suited for use in the following applications: - RF amplifiers - Oscillators - High-frequency signal amplification circuits
